Consider Pant Length
When it comes to pant length, there are technically four options available, no break, quarter break, half break, or full break. Pant alteration depends on two things: personal preference and height. Besides, you can also prefer styles and trends occurring throughout the fashion world. You also need to consider the shoe type you intend to wear with your suit.
Blazer Length
Ideally, the length of your suit should be aligned with your knuckles. Another way to observe the suit length is by noticing your hand length. If your hand is too exposed while remaining inside the jacket, going for a size up would be a good choice. The back length of your jacket should be enough to cover the curvature of your buttock. If the suit jacket exposes your butt too much, it is probably too long or too short. It is recommended to either size up or down to fix the issue using an alteration technique.

Blazer sleeves
Altering sleeve length is essential to get your blazer perfectly altered. Put your hands down and check the sleeve length; if your shirt sleeve is just visible, the measurement of your sleeve is just right, however, if the shirt sleeve is too much visible, the blazer is too short, and if the shirt sleeve is not visible at all, the blazer length is too long.
